Dental implants, unlike dentures, are not removable, which most people find preferable and more comfortable. They are also preferable to dentures in that they last longer. They differ from bridges in that they are anchored in the jaw. Unlike bridges, which can damage the teeth to which they are attached, they do not rely on neighboring teeth for support.
Dental implants are made to resemble your real teeth both in look and in feel. If you are generally healthy and take good care of your teeth, then you may want to consider this procedure. However, a dentist will have to ensure that your jaw bones are thick enough to insert the titanium rod into. Prosthetic teeth, however, will need the same oral care as ordinary teeth.
A titanium root is implanted into either jaw where it acts as a natural root. Titanium is used as it is a metal around which the bone will easily grow. The new root then anchors the artificial tooth. This type of prosthetic tooth is called a crown.
With regard to look, color and feel you will not know the difference between your crown and your real teeth. Your dentist takes an imprint of your real tooth which he sends to the lab. There they make you a crown exactly to your measurements. The color is also chosen specially so that the prosthesis will not stand out from your real teeth.
Getting a crown is not a quick procedure and you will need to visit your dentist a number of times. First he must take the measurements for your crown and get you ready for your new tooth. Then you have to wait while until it arrives from the laboratory. Only then can it be fitted. It is important that your dentist makes sure that it is a perfect fit to avoid later problems.

The Nurses Uniforms History could start with the Middle Ages. Most of the nursing duties were performed in monasteries. The monks and nuns in their conventional dress tended to the poor and rich alike. Nurses from the 1600s to the 1800s were not looked upon as experts in the field and were usually viewed as having low morals. That view came about because unmarried women nurses stayed overnight in the homes of their patient or in hospital basements. Sometimes parties and drinking in the hospital lent to the bad reputation of the nurses.
It was not until the mid-1800s that partially trained nurses were employed by cities or local health districts to attend to the poor who could not afford the attention of a doctor. Their uniform was ladylike and often matronly in nature.
In the mid-1800s, Florence Nightingale, the daughter of a rich British landowner, refused her parents plans to marry her into a station of life befitting the times. She wanted a medical career in nursing. Due to her, nursing rose in position socially and uniforms began took on a more professional look. The professional nurses uniforms displayed obvious differences from those of the untrained. The nurses uniforms were covered with pinafore like aprons with capped sleeves, and hung to nearly floor length. Hats, or caps, had chin straps that resembled those of nuns gave an appearance of quality.
World War I made it obvious that the previously strict nursing styles were not practical in the throes of war. The wounded and dying needed to be cared for in with efficient and quick service. While the skirts shortened, the sleeves became either short or rolled up, and often times the aprons disappeared completely.
World War II brought about even more startling changes, and distinct uniforms of military nurses were of blue and olive and became even shorter according to dress modes of the day. Caps took on a military appearance, and were more efficient. There were also various colors and insignias according to the nurses area of military service or rank, but usually were in a shirtwaist style.
Nurses uniforms in the 1950s were more feminine looking with short sleeves and covered by a bib apron with shoulder straps. Caps were often in pill box style.
The 1960s saw a change to a slightly more casual look as open collars appeared, and scrubs became popular in the United States. Scrubs were reserved for the operating theatre in the United Kingdom however. Paper caps that were disposable came into use in the 1970s and later in the 1980s disposable plastic aprons began to be used.

Gastric Bypass Surgery, or weight-loss surgery, has become a very common procedure to help people suffering from obesity lose the excess weight. One important concern many women have when considering gastric bypass surgery is if there are any cautions to getting pregnant after undergoing the procedure.
Because gastric bypass causes the food to bypass the stomach and sections of the small intestine, one major side effect of gastric bypass is a decrease of nutrient and calorie absorption. Nutritional complications associated with gastric bypass surgery are deficiencies in B12, iron, calcium, and vitamin D. Nutrients are not absorbed so women run the risk of becoming anemic and developing other nutritional deficiencies. There have also been some cases where patients have developed protein-calorie malnutrition and fat malabsorption after having gastric bypass surgery. After surgery, many women consume as little as 500 calories a day so they will often take vitamins and mineral supplements to compensate for the nutrient loss.
Nutritional supplements can help ward off gastric by pass nutrient deficiencies, however, many experts recommend that women make sure their nutrient levels are normal before they get pregnant and that their nutrient levels are monitored throughout the pregnancy. Many experts recommend waiting 18 months after gastric bypass surgery to reduce the risk of developing nutritional deficiencies that can affect the mother and the baby.
Many medical experts recommend that if a woman thinks she may be pregnant, she avoid having a gastric bypass until after birth. If a woman wants to become pregnant after gastric bypass, she should weight until her weight has stabilized because the body goes through stressful changes and considerable nutritional disruption, which can potentially cause problems for the developing fetus. It is recommended that women wait 18 months after the surgery before getting pregnant because by then she should have reached a stable weight and be able to provide her baby with sufficient nutrition.
It has been shown that having gastric bypass can actually result in a boost in fertility. For instance, a woman having problems conceiving due to obesity will actually start ovulating after the surgery. Women who are afflicted with polycystic ovarian syndrome (PCOS) can also get a boost in fertility after having gastric bypass because research has shown that women with PCOS who have had the surgery had their reproductive abnormalities resolved.
For women who have had gastric bypass surgery and became pregnant shortly after the surgery, their health care providers will monitor them carefully during their pregnancy to make sure there are no problems with the mom and the baby. Medicine has been practiced since very early times. Herbalism has been used from the very earliest times and involved using animal parts and minerals. These and other materials were also used in ritualistic practices by priests, shamans and medicine men.
The first records of the use of medicine can be traced to the early Egyptian civilization and to Babylonia and also to India. At the same time, its use was also recorded in early Chinese civilizations and also in the earliest Greek and Roman civilizations. The name of the first physician was Imhotep and it was he who practiced medicine in about the 3rd Millennium BC.
Sri Lanka had the first real hospital where patients came to be treated. Sushruta was an Indian surgeon and probably the first to practice his art. He is believed to be the first person to have performed a kind of plastic surgery.
Hippocrates is considered the father of medicine as he was responsible for laying the foundation of a more rational medicinal approach. The Hippocratic Oath for physicians is still used today and it was Hippocrates who categorized illnesses according to levels of severity including endemic, chronic, acute and epidemic. He was also the first to coin terms such as relapse, and exacerbation and paroxysm and crisis as well as convalescence and peak.
A Greek physician by the name of Galen is considered the finest surgeon from the early civilizations and it was he who was credited for performing some truly outstanding surgeries including of the eyes and also the brain.

Hippotherapy is a type of therapy that has been used to help people who have had traumatic brain injuries, cognitive disabilities, autism, and even speech impediments. The term hippo is borrowed from the Greek language The word means horse, and hippotherapy is a type of therapeutic riding.
Winston Churchill once made a comment about there being something undefinable about horses that was good for mankind. Hippotherapy proves that he was correct. In addition to seeing the condition that the patient is being treated for improve after several hippotherapy sessions, many caretakers have noticed that they patient also seems to be changing in other ways as well. They seem to be experimenting a healing process that is spiritual, psychological, and physical. It is something that is rarely seen with other types of therapy programs.
Physically the reason hippotherapy is go good is easy to understand. Even though the horse has four legs instead of two, it walks in the same three dimensional manner that humans do. This movement allows for the person to be put through the same therapy routines that they would be in a gym, but their entire body is always in motion, making the therapy session more beneficial Like swimming, horseback riding is also a form of non-weight bearing exercises.
The constant movement of the horse is not the only way that the patient benefits. Riding is something makes use of all senses. They have a distinct scent and a feel. Horses perceive the world differently. One of the reasons horses are such a great therapeutic tool is that a person who is self conscious can finally deal with another living creature and not have to worry about being judged. Most horses tend to think that all humans are good, and will love a person no matter what their physical or mental condition might be. The horse provides a sense of safety that the patient might not be able to find when they are away from the barn.
It is not enough for a person to decide they want to become involved in a hippotherapy program, there is a process that they first have to go through. Before entering the program they have to make sure that there is not a physical reason why they should not be mounted on a horse. One the person has been approved they will be working with either an occupational or physical therapist who is assisted by a therapeutic riding instructor. Together the pair devise a program that is designed to give the most benefit to the patient.
Not every horse is suitable for hippotherapy. Before they can be integrated into the program the horse is put through an extensive evaluation program. The horse must display a good personality, meet a certain level of training, and also have gaits that are suitable for the program.
Hippotherapy is not a new idea. It has been around for more than 30 years. One of the problems hippotherapy programs have run into is a lack of cooperation from the medical field. It is not unusual for doctors to question the therapeutic benefits of riding around the arena. However, recently more and more doctors have started to see changes in their patients that happened only after the patient became involved in a therapeutic riding program. Today respected organizations such as The American Physical Therapy Association, American Speech and Hearing Association, and American Occupational Therapy Association recognize hippotherapy as a valuable physical therapy tool.
